4. Hands-on Testing: Prototyping and Physical Validation

A concept is only as good as its real-world performance. That’s why we build prototypes and put them to the test under realistic conditions.

Testing happens in several phases:

  • Technical testing: We assess durability, seams, material behavior, air distribution, and safety.
  • User testing: How do kids and adults move on the module? Are there hidden risks? Is it fun?
  • Weather testing: We test durability against UV exposure, saltwater resistance, wind behavior and many other technical requirements.

We involve test users and internal Wibit Sports teams who use the modules in trial pools or open water settings – often over several weeks.

5. Safety First: Standards and Certifications

Wibit Sports stands for certified quality worldwide. That’s why every new module undergoes extensive safety evaluations to meet international standards.

  • ISO and TĂśV certifications: Every product must pass these rigorous tests.
  • Global standards: All modules comply with international safety norms to ensure worldwide usability and approval.
  • Safety features: No entrapment hazards, no sharp edges, easy supervision and intuitive design are some of the many features we consider for maximum safety.

Wibit Sports is a permanent member of the ISO standard committee for inflatable water sport devices – for us, safety is not a trend, it’s a commitment.
